1. Are People Reading Your Blog?

One way to tell if your blog is successful is by looking at your traffic. Are people actually reading your blog?

It’s important to keep track of your blog’s traffic, because it can be a good indicator of how well your blog is doing. If you see a sudden spike in traffic, that’s usually a good sign that people are interested in what you’re writing about.

Of course, there are other ways to measure success besides traffic. But if you’re looking for a quick way to see if people are reading your blog, checking your traffic is a good place to start.

So, how do you check your blog’s traffic? There are a few different ways.

One popular way is to use Google Analytics. Google Analytics is a free service you can use to track your website’s traffic. Just sign up for a free account, add your blog, and you’re ready to go.

2. Are People Commenting on Your Blog?

Another way to tell if your blog is successful is by looking at the comments. If people are regularly commenting on your blog, that’s a good sign that they’re enjoying your content.

Of course, not every blog is going to have hundreds of comments on every post. But if you see a consistent stream of comments, it’s a good sign that people are engaged with your blog.

One thing to keep in mind, though, is that not all comments are created equal. A thoughtful, well-written comment is worth more than a dozen generic “great post” comments. So don’t get too discouraged if you don’t see a ton of comments on your blog. Just focus on quality over quantity.

If you’re not sure how to encourage comments on your blog, there are a few things you can try.

First, make it easy for people to comment. If your commenting system is complicated to use, people will be less likely to leave a comment.

Second, respond to comments. When people take the time to leave a comment, it’s a good idea to respond. This shows that you’re listening to your readers and that you value their input.

Finally, don’t be afraid to ask for comments. If you’re not getting many comments, try asking your readers for their thoughts on a specific topic. This can be a great way to get a conversation started.

3. Are People Sharing Your Blog?

If people are sharing your blog with their friends, that’s a great sign that they like it and think it’s worth reading. But how can you tell if people are actually sharing your blog?

Here are a few ways to find out:

A. Check your social media stats.

If you’re active on social media, take a look at your stats to see how many people are sharing your blog posts. If you see a significant increase in shares, that’s a good sign that people are finding your content valuable.

Setting up a social listening stream is the best way to track mentions. This will assist you in cutting through the noise and focusing on the voices you want to hear. Hootsuite’s Mentions stream allows you to track your social mentions on Twitter and Facebook.

B. Look at your traffic patterns.

If you have Google Analytics set up on your site, take a look at your traffic patterns to see where your visitors are coming from. If you see a lot of referral traffic from social media sites, that’s a good sign that people are sharing your blog.

4. Are You Making Money From Your Blog?

Are you making money from your blog? If you’re able to monetize your blog, that’s a good sign that it’s successful. However, it’s not the only metric that matters. You also need to take into account things like engagement, reach, and even just the pure enjoyability of writing your blog.

But if you are monetizing your blog, congrats! You’re on your way to becoming a professional blogger. Here are a few tips on how to make the most of it:

Sell advertising space.

One of the most common ways to make money from a blog is to sell advertising space.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as Google AdSense or direct ad sales.

Sell products or services.

If you have a product or service to sell, you can use your blog to promote it.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as affiliate marketing or selling products directly from your blog.

Offer consulting or coaching services.

Another way to make money from your blog is to offer consulting or coaching services. This can be done by setting up a coaching program or offering one-on-one consulting sessions.

Create and sell e-books or other digital products.

If you have expertise in a particular area, you can create and sell e-books or other digital products.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as creating a digital product and selling it on your blog or through a third-party platform like Amazon Kindle.

Offer paid subscriptions.

Another way to make money from your blog is to offer paid subscriptions. This can be done by setting up a subscription-based service or offering paid content on your blog.

Host paid webinars or courses.

If you have knowledge or expertise in a particular area, you can host paid webinars or courses.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as setting up a webinar platform or offering paid courses on your blog.

Sell physical products.

If you have a physical product to sell, you can use your blog to promote it.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as setting up an online store or selling products through a third-party platform like Etsy.

Offer services.

If you have a service to offer, you can use your blog to promote it. This can be done through a variety of methods, such as offering services on a freelance basis or setting up a service-based business.
